    S20E23: How Walmart Keeps Prices Low

    Send us a text Walmart is making a push on U.S. manufacturing, and says it’s good business. Today, Jenny Rae and Namaan break down what’s signal versus spin, where onshoring can actually cut costs, and why category-by-category moves matter more than headline percentages. We get into supplier power, inventory timing, vertical integration in beef, and pharma basics like bringing amoxicillin back onshore. Plus, a personal investing lesson from Jenny Rae’s grandmother: buy what you never plan to sell. Tell us how you shop at Walmart and what you’re seeing in prices where you live.     S20E21: The Secret Behind Delta’s Record Profits and Sky-High Margins

    Send us a text Delta just posted blockbuster earnings, and it’s not because more people are flying. Jenny Rae and Namaan unpack how Delta’s $8B profit engine runs on premium seats, credit card partnerships, and a bet on wealthy travellers. They dive into what makes Delta’s “premium economy” the most profitable cabin in the sky, why Buffett once got airlines wrong, and how rivals like United and Southwest are scrambling to catch up.     S20E17: No Target School, No Chance? Michael Proved Them Wrong and Got BCG

    Send us a text What if you didn’t go to a target school? What if you’re an international student who needs sponsorship? Does that mean MBB is out of reach? Michael Liu is living proof that the answer is no. In this episode, Japheth sits down with Michael, an undergraduate student from Taiwan who defied the odds to land a BCG internship. Michael shares the exact steps he took to break in, including: How he built a powerful networking strategyOvercame the sponsorship hurdlePrepared for both case and behavioral interviewsHis story is full of practical insights and encouragement you can apply to your own recruiting journey — whether you’re at a non-target school, navigating visa questions, or just looking for that extra edge.     S20E16: Why Warren Buffett Just Bet $10 Billion on Chemicals

    Send us a text Warren Buffett is still making big moves at 95 years old. His latest play? A $10 billion bet on OxyChem, the petrochemical arm of Occidental. In this episode of Market Outsiders, Namaan and Jenny Rae unpack what makes this deal stand out. They break down the financial engineering behind it, why debt reduction matters in today’s macro climate, and how it fits into the broader Buffett Playbook.  From shareholder buybacks to Buffett’s trademark “handshake” style, this is a masterclass in deal dynamics.
